This is my engagement/wedding ring. It's 20 k white gold with a European cut diamond and two sapphires (I'm a sapphire girl - I admit it), made in the 1920's. The engravings remind me of the art deco style, but I'm not great with jewelry - I'd have to ask my husband (he was a jeweler before I convinced him to go into engineering). My great grandmother was a total bitch (not in the fun way) but had a fabulous fashion sense. I inherited it, and it's the only piece of jewelry from that family that survived my family's house burning down.

It's a little bit large on me now, due to weight loss, but I won't re-size it due to it being an heirloom.
